sky-take-out/sky-server/src/main/java/com/sky/mapper/DishFlavorMapper.java

34 lines
715 B
Java

package com.sky.mapper;
import com.sky.entity.DishFlavor;
import org.apache.ibatis.annotations.Mapper;
import java.util.List;
@Mapper
public interface DishFlavorMapper {
/**
* 香口味表中插入n条数据
* @param flavors List<DishFlavor>
*/
void insertBatch(List<DishFlavor> flavors);
/**
* 删除菜品关联的口味数据
* @param id Long
*/
void deleteByDishId(Long id);
/**
* 删除菜品关联的口味数据
* @param dishIds List<Long>
*/
void deleteByDishIds(List<Long> dishIds);
/**
* 根据菜品id查询口味数据
* @param id Long
* @return DishFlavor
*/
List<DishFlavor> getByDishId(Long id);
}